During the recent Board of Mayor and Aldermen (BOMA) meeting in Franklin, a heartfelt tribute was paid to Officer Ryan Schuman, who has dedicated 25 years of service to the city as a police officer. Recognized for his significant contributions, Officer Schuman has also served as the public affairs officer, playing a vital role in fostering community trust and safety.

Mayor Ken Moore praised Schuman for his engaging personality and commitment to the community, highlighting his efforts in building connections and ensuring public safety during meetings. Schuman's presence at BOMA and planning commission meetings has made him a familiar and trusted figure among residents.

In addition to his law enforcement career, Schuman is also an Air Force veteran, further underscoring his dedication to serving both his country and community. As he prepares to embark on the next chapter of his life, the city expressed deep gratitude for his years of service and the positive impact he has made in Franklin.
